The Duty of an Appellate Attorney

In the world of appellate legislation, the role of an appellate attorney is crucial in navigating the intricacies of higher court process and advocating for customers seeking appellate evaluation. Appellate lawyers concentrate on dealing with instances on allure, where the focus shifts from truths and proof presented at test to legal arguments and procedural issues. Their primary duty is to assess trial records, identify lawful errors, carry out legal research, draft convincing briefs, and existing dental arguments before appellate courts.



In addition, appellate lawyers serve as critical advisors to test attorneys, leading them on maintaining lawful concerns for possible appeal and creating solid legal arguments throughout the test procedure. They should have a deep understanding of appellate rules, treatments, and instance legislation to efficiently represent their customers' interests. Furthermore, appellate attorneys play an important role fit the regulation by advocating for lawful principles that can set criteria influencing future instances. In general, their proficiency and advocacy abilities are vital in seeking justice for customers via the appellate process.

Browsing the Appeals Process


Effectively navigating the allures procedure calls for a tactical understanding of procedural rules and timelines within the appellate court system. The process commonly begins with submitting a notice of allure within a defined duration after a final judgment is gone into at the test court degree (mesquite texas appeals attorney). When the notification of charm is submitted, the applicant has to after that put together the record on appeal, that includes appropriate records, records, and displays from the high court proceedings

After the record is assembled, the applicant composes a persuasive appellate brief laying out the lawful debates supporting their setting. This record is vital as it provides the appellate court with a detailed evaluation of the legal issues in contention. Ultimately, both events might have the chance to present oral disagreements prior to the appellate panel, defending their placements and dealing with any kind of questions raised by the courts.

Throughout this procedure, appellate attorneys should stick to rigorous procedural regulations and due dates to ensure their debates are heard and considered by the appellate court. By mastering these ins and outs, lawyers can effectively browse the allures procedure and advocate for their clients' rate of interests.
